The Cresco Country Club will host an Oktoberfest celebration on Saturday, Oct. 1. The clubhouse will open at 12 noon with free admission and offer live music by Joe Majors, fun bouncy houses and crafts for the kids, games for the adults such as Hammerschlagen, a Keg Throw and more. CRESCO - Mr. Kris Einck took the helm at Howard-Winneshiek CSD on July 1. He moved one county to the west from his previous position as superintendent and secondary principal at South Winneshiek CSD.

CRESCO - Crestwood High School held its 2022 Homecoming Coronation on Sunday, Sept. 18. Christopher Bigalk was named the King while Grace Prochaska was tabbed as the Queen.
